Which coffee machine is best for home?
Espresso coffee machines might live in the kitchen, but for many Aussies, it’s the true heart of the home. From manual models to automatic all-rounders, you’ll find something for every kind of coffee lover at Harvey Norman:
- Manual Coffee Machines – Love getting hands-on? Manual machines let you grind, tamp, and pull the shot yourself, just like your favourite barista.
- Automatic Coffee Machines – These do all the heavy lifting, from grinding coffee beans to frothing the milk – all at the press of a button.
- Capsule Coffee Machines – Fast and foolproof. Just pop in a compatible capsule and press go for a consistently good cuppa.
- Built-in Coffee Machines – Blending seamlessly into your cabinetry, built-ins offer the convenience of an automatic machine without taking up bench space.
- Drip Coffee Machines – Great for brewing big batches, these filter coffee makers slowly drip hot water over ground coffee for a more mellow flavour.

How much should I spend on an espresso machine?
We get it – regular trips to your barista can really add up. Here’s the good news: getting a cafe-style coffee at home has never been easier (or more affordable).
Whether you’re looking for a simple setup or a machine with all the bells and whistles, we have coffee makers for every budget:
- Entry-Level Machines – Looking to spend up to $400? Pod and compact options like the Nespresso Vertuo Pop or Breville Bambino are great for quick, fuss-free brews on a cheaper budget.
- Mid-Range Machines – Between $500 to $1,200, you’ll find favourites like Breville Barista Express, DeLonghi La Specialista, and Ninja Luxe Café, which offer more control over your cup.
- Premium Machines – Reaching prices up to $4,000, high-end models like Jura E8 and Breville The Oracle Jet deliver more advanced features for baristas recreating the full café experience in their own home.
What should I look for when buying a coffee machine?
With so many options brewing online and in-store at Harvey Norman, it’s worth considering these things before you buy a home coffee machine:
- Budget – With espresso machines ranging from entry-level to the best that money can buy, the very first step in your coffee journey is setting a budget.
- Grinder – Decide whether you’d prefer a built-in conical burr grinder or invest in a standalone coffee grinder for more flexibility.
- Power – After something that heats up in seconds? Check the wattage to make sure the machine can keep up with your pace (and your pre-coffee patience).
- Features – Make a list of the must-haves to find your dream machine, like pre-infusion, PID control, dual boilers, or a built-in cup warmer.
- Design – Looks matter when it takes pride of place on the bench, so choose one that suits your personal space and style.
- Coffee Accessories – From cleaning tablets and descaler to a quality portafilter or milk frother, don’t forget the extras to enhance your coffee-making experience.
